  • The Satellit 750 is not a simple analog radio. It is a hybrid digital/analog dual-conversion superheterodyne receiver featuring DSP (Digital Signal Processing) filtering, a synchronous detector, and a complex PLL (Phase-Locked Loop) system. Unlike a 1970s tube radio, you cannot fix a 750 with just a multimeter and a soldering iron. grundig satellit 750 service manual

    The electroluminescent (EL) backlight panels in the 750 have a limited lifespan. The manual includes the inverter circuit diagram (usually near the power supply section). Using this, you can measure high-voltage AC output and determine if you need a new EL panel or a replacement inverter IC.

    Once you obtain the service manual, do not just leave it on a hard drive. Print the schematic pages at a local copy shop at 11"x17" (Tabloid size). Laminate the PCB layout page so you can mark it with a dry-erase marker during repairs.

    The optical encoder for the main tuning dial is prone to dust and wear. The radio will jump frequencies erratically. The service manual provides the exact pinout for the encoder and the schematic for the debouncing circuit, allowing you to test whether the issue is the encoder itself or a capacitor on the MCU input line.
